摘要
The aim of this study was to investigate the mechanism by which lactoferrin (LF) protects against development of LPS-induced endotoxemia in mice. CBA mice were given 5 mg bovine LF intravenously (i.v.) or per os 24 hr prior to i.v. injection of 50 mu g LPS. Two hours after LPS injection mice were bled and serum levels of TNF-alpha, IL-6 and IL-10 were determined. The results showed that LF alone given i.v. or per os increased the production of TNF-alpha, IL-6 and IL-10 to various degrees. Mice treated with LF 24 hr before LPS injection showed a significantly reduced release of TNF-alpha, and to lesser degree IL-6 and IL-10. The protective effect of LF against development of LPS-induced endotoxemia was associated with a significant increase of the IL-10 to TNF-alpha ratio.
